Where to stay in Cathedral Quarter

Find the best Cathedral Quarter areas and neighborhoods for the activities you enjoy most.

Belfast City Centre

Centred around Donegall Square, Belfast City Centre boasts the iconic Waterfront Hall, Victoria Square's commercial and leisure hub, and historic landmarks like Albert Clock and City Hall. Easily accessible via Belfast Suburban Rail stations.

Belfast Central District

The fantastic nightlife and popular shops are just a few highlights of Belfast Central District. Make a stop by Ulster Hall or Belfast Christmas Market while you're exploring the area.

Queens Quarter

Queens Quarter is a destination visitors seek out for is ample dining options, fascinating museums, and picturesque gardens. You might also want to check out attractions like Belfast Botanic Gardens or Ulster Museum while you're exploring the neighborhood.

Titanic Quarter

Waterfront regeneration with historic maritime landmarks, Titanic Quarter offers the Titanic Belfast attraction, Catalyst Inc science park, and Belfast Harbour Marina. Accessible via Translink Metro Services and NI Railways.

Ballymacarret

While visiting Ballymacarret, you might make a stop by sights like CS Lewis Square and Belfast Oval.

Shopping

The Cathedral Quarter offers great shopping experiences. Victoria Square Shopping Centre, 483m away, features diverse shops and entertainment. Castle Court Shopping Centre, also 483m distant, provides a family-friendly atmosphere. For local goods, head to St. George's Market, located 805m from the Quarter.

Recreation

Experience the vibrant atmosphere at SSE Arena, where you can catch thrilling sports events. Enjoy live performances at Ulster Hall, a hub for music lovers. For a touch of luxury, indulge in a round of golf at the Royal Portrush Golf Club, surrounded by stunning landscapes.

Adventure

At Jetpack Adventures, soar above the water with thrilling jetpack experiences, located 3.2km from Cathedral Quarter. For speed enthusiasts, Eddie Irvine Sports offers exhilarating karting 16.1km away. For a scenic hike, explore Blackhead Path, a picturesque trail 24.1km from the city, surrounded by stunning views.

Nightlife

Experience the vibrant nightlife in Cathedral Quarter. Catch a show at the historic Grand Opera House, or enjoy innovative performances at the MAC Theatre just 161m away. For a movie night, Cineworld Belfast offers the latest films, making it perfect for families and couples alike.

Best time to go to Cathedral Quarter

The best time to visit Cathedral Quarter is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January40.8°F (4.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
February41.4°F (5.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
March42.8°F (6.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
April46.2°F (7.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
May50.9°F (10.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
June55.9°F (13.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
July58.3°F (14.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
August57.7°F (14.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
September55.0°F (12.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
October50.9°F (10.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
November45.7°F (7.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
December42.3°F (5.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low

The nearest major airports for your trip to Cathedral Quarter

When visiting Cathedral Quarter in Belfast, you can fly into two major airports. George Best Belfast City Airport (BHD) is located 3.2km away and offers convenient access to nearby hotels such as The Merchant Hotel and The Fitzwilliam Hotel, both 2-4.8km from the airport. Alternatively, Belfast International Airport (BFS) is 13.2km away, with hotel options like the Doubletree by Hilton Belfast Templepatrick and Dunadry Hotel and Gardens within 4-9.7km of the airport. For travelers considering Londonderry, City of Derry Airport (LDY) is 93.3km away, with accommodations like Bishop's Gate Hotel and Best Western Plus White Horse Hotel nearby.

What can I see and do in this Belfast neighborhood?
Belfast Customs House, Albert Memorial Clock Tower, and St. Anne's Cathedral are landmarks that can't be missed during your stay in Cathedral Quarter. You could also plan a visit to MAC Theatre or Big Fish while you're in the neighborhood. Titanic Belfast, Oh Yeah Music Centre, and Metropolitan Arts Centre are just a few of the places to visit in and around Cathedral Quarter. While you're out sightseeing, Obel and Transport House are a couple of additional sights to visit in Belfast.
